Maison  >  Article  >  développement back-end  >  Meilleures pratiques pour la gestion des données avec PHP et Typecho

Meilleures pratiques pour la gestion des données avec PHP et Typecho

WBOY
WBOYoriginal
2023-07-21 08:43:51694parcourir

PHP et Typecho mettent en œuvre les meilleures pratiques en matière de gestion des données

Avec le développement d'Internet, la construction et la gestion de sites Web deviennent de plus en plus importantes. En tant que système de blog open source, Typecho offre un moyen simple et efficace de créer un blog personnel. En tant que langage de programmation largement utilisé dans les scripts serveur, PHP complète Typecho et lui apporte de puissantes fonctions de gestion de données. Cet article expliquera comment utiliser PHP et Typecho pour mettre en œuvre les meilleures pratiques de gestion des données.

  1. Créer une connexion à la base de données
    Pour utiliser PHP pour gérer les données, vous devez d'abord créer une connexion à la base de données. Voici un exemple de code :
<?php
$servername = "localhost";  //数据库服务器地址
$username = "root";  //数据库用户名
$password = "password";  //数据库密码
$dbname = "database";  //数据库名称

//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);

// 检测连接是否成功
if ($conn->connect_error) {
  die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>
  1. Query Database
    Ensuite, nous pouvons utiliser PHP pour interroger la base de données et obtenir les données requises. Voici un exemple de code pour interroger la base de données :
<?php
$sql = "SELECT * FROM table_name";  //要查询的数据库表和字段

$result = $conn->query($sql);

if ($result->num_rows > 0) {
  while($row = $result->fetch_assoc()) {
    echo "字段1: " . $row["column1"]. " - 字段2: " . $row["column2"]. "<br>";
  }
} else {
  echo "没有数据";
}
$conn->close();
?>
  1. Insérer des données
    En plus d'interroger des données, nous pouvons également utiliser PHP pour insérer des données dans la base de données. Voici un exemple de code :
<?php
$sql = "INSERT INTO table_name (column1, column2, column3)
VALUES ('value1', 'value2', 'value3')";

if ($conn->query($sql) === TRUE) {
  echo "数据插入成功";
} else {
  echo "数据插入失败: " . $conn->error;
}
$conn->close();
?>
  1. Mettre à jour et supprimer des données
    En utilisant PHP, vous pouvez également mettre à jour et supprimer des données dans la base de données. Voici un exemple de code pour mettre à jour les données :
<?php
$sql = "UPDATE table_name SET column1='new_value' WHERE condition";

if ($conn->query($sql) === TRUE) {
  echo "数据更新成功";
} else {
  echo "数据更新失败: " . $conn->error;
}
$conn->close();
?>

Ce qui suit est un exemple de code pour supprimer des données :

<?php
$sql = "DELETE FROM table_name WHERE condition";

if ($conn->query($sql) === TRUE) {
  echo "数据删除成功";
} else {
  echo "数据删除失败: " . $conn->error;
}
$conn->close();
?>
  1. Conclusion
    En utilisant PHP et Typecho, nous pouvons facilement implémenter des fonctions de gestion de données. Qu'il s'agisse d'interroger, d'insérer, de mettre à jour ou de supprimer des données, PHP offre une multitude de fonctions et de syntaxes pour répondre à nos besoins. En utilisant ces fonctions de manière flexible, nous pouvons créer un système de site Web et de blog puissant.

J'espère que l'exemple de code et les meilleures pratiques de cet article pourront vous aider et vous permettre de mieux utiliser PHP et Typecho pour la gestion des données. Je vous souhaite un plus grand succès dans le monde en ligne !

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n